TROTTING.
tIC TELEGRAPH —PRESS ASSN., COPYRIGHT. CHRISTCHURCH, Alarcli 21. Air James Brennan (President of the West Australian Trotting Association) has sent Air P. Solig (President of the N.Z. Trotting Association), a cable message, giving some further information regarding the championship trotting contests, which are being held in Perth. Air Brennan, in his message
The New Zealand horses, cspccially Gi-eat Hope were not at their best, owing to a slight iurther mishap. Ihe concluding event, the two miles race, "ill he decided next. Saturday, and in mv opinion. Great Hope "ill "in, U anything like liim.sell. Air J. Bryce, j 1Ir..1 r.. the driver of Great Hope, is not too lit, having received an injury to two of his ribs. The points scored sc far are:- -Van Direct G, Kola Girl 4. Great Hope 3. Tara ire 1.
